Abstract

Summary form only given. We report the first room temperature, continuous wave operation of an optical flip-flop in which there are two stable lasing states, in close analogy to a S-R latch in electrical circuits. Bistable laser diodes have important applications as optical memory elements in future high-speed all-optical time-division switching systems, as demonstrated by Suzuki, see J. of Lightwave Technology, vol.LT-4, p.894, 1986. Compared with the two section, single mode bistable laser diode used in their experiment which must be turned off electrically, this device can be reset by the application of an optical trigger and is therefore more flexible.
